更改 /etc/network/interfaces 中的 mac 地址有多可靠?

更改 /etc/network/interfaces 中的 mac 地址有多可靠?

我正在运行 ubuntu 服务器 10.04 如果我通过添加(在 /etc/network/interfaces 中)来更改 mac 地址

hwaddress ether 12:34:56:78:9A:BC

这有多可靠?有人还能确定我的真实 MAC 地址吗?

答案1

您必须定义“某人”。如果有人离您的 PC 足够近,可以获取您的 MAC 地址(1 跳),那么如果他们真的想要,他们可能就能获取到它。MAC 欺骗只是一种软件功能。真正的 MAC 通常存储在卡本身的只读存储器中。如果机器启动到没有地址欺骗的另一个操作系统,则会显示您的真实地址。

答案2

如果你想在内核级别更改 MAC 地址,可以使用名为麦克查格. 它还可以随机化给定接口的 MAC 地址。

唯一的问题是,如果您的网络依赖于 DHCP,您每次都会获得不同的 IP 地址。这会很快使 DHCP 服务器的租约缓存达到最大值。

相关内容